I’m Tired of Playing Good Girl Roles, Says Linda Ejiofor-Suleiman
Actress Linda Ejiofor-Suleiman has spoken out about her desire to take on more challenging roles in movies. In a recent interview, she expressed that she is tired of always playing the good girl and wants to explore villainous characters.
This comes after her impressive performance that earned her a major award at the Africa Magic Viewers Choice Awards (AMVCA).
Linda revealed that winning the AMVCA award was a groundbreaking moment in her career. The recognition has boosted her confidence and opened new doors in the entertainment industry. She believes taking on negative roles will help her grow as an actress and show her range and talent.
As the wife of fellow actor Ibrahim Suleiman, Linda also shared insights into balancing her marriage and acting career. She described how the couple supports each other in the demanding world of Nollywood. Their relationship has become a source of strength as they both pursue their dreams in the movie industry.
